Strategy Visa Sponsorship Jobs in West Virginia
Strategy roles in West Virginia span consulting, operations, and business development across industries including energy, healthcare, and government services. Major employers in Charleston and Morgantown, including West Virginia University and health systems like WVU Medicine, have sponsored international talent for strategy-oriented positions requiring advanced analytical and planning expertise.

Which companies in West Virginia sponsor visas for strategy roles?
WVU Medicine and West Virginia University are among the more active sponsors for strategy and planning roles in the state. Energy companies operating in the Appalachian basin, along with government contractors based in Charleston, have also filed sponsorship petitions for business strategy positions. Sponsorship activity is less concentrated than in major metro areas, so identifying specific employers requires research into DOL disclosure data.
Which visa types are most common for strategy roles in West Virginia?
The H-1B visa is the most common visa for strategy professionals in West Virginia, as most roles require at least a bachelor's degree in business, economics, or a related field, meeting the specialty occupation standard. Candidates with outstanding achievements may qualify for the O-1 visa. Australians in strategy roles should consider the E-3 visa, which has no lottery and processes faster. TN visa status is available to Canadians and Mexicans in qualifying management analyst roles.
Which cities in West Virginia have the most strategy sponsorship jobs?
Charleston, the state capital, hosts the highest concentration of strategy roles given its government, healthcare, and energy sector presence. Morgantown is the second most active market, driven by West Virginia University and its affiliated research and medical institutions. Huntington has a smaller but present base of healthcare and nonprofit organizations that occasionally sponsor international professionals for planning and strategy functions.

Are there state-specific considerations for strategy visa sponsorship in West Virginia?
West Virginia's smaller labor market means fewer open strategy roles overall, which makes timing and employer targeting more important. Prevailing wage requirements under the H-1B apply statewide and are set by DOL using Bureau of Labor Statistics data for the specific metropolitan or non-metropolitan area. Strategy roles tied to WVU or federally funded research programs may qualify for cap-exempt H-1B petitions, which are not subject to the annual lottery.
What is the prevailing wage for sponsored strategy jobs in West Virginia?
U.S. employers sponsoring a visa must pay at least the prevailing wage, which is what workers in the same role, area, and experience level typically earn. The Department of Labor sets this rate to make sure companies aren't hiring foreign workers simply because they'd accept lower pay than a U.S. worker. It varies by job title, location, and experience. You can look up current prevailing wage rates for any occupation and location using the OFLC Wage Search page.
